Gargle:
Gargles are aqueous solutions to prevent & treat throat infections & are used to relieve
soreness in mild throat infections.
Mouthwash:
Mouth washes are aqueous solutions with pleasant taste and odour used to make clean&
deodorize buccal cavity.
Uses of Douches:
1) Cleaning agent’s e.g. Isotonic sodium chloride solution.
2) Antiseptics: e.g. mercuric chloride (0.001%), potassium permanganate (0.025%),
lacticacid (0.5 to 2%),Chlorohexidine ( 0.002%)
3) Astringent e.g.alum(1%),
